On 11/03/15 11:44, Ross Lagerwall wrote:
> On some systems, the ResetSystem EFI runtime service is broken. Follow the
> Linux (and Windows) way by preferring ACPI reboot over EFI reboot. This is
> done by making BOOT_EFI a reboot mode similar to BOOT_ACPI and BOOT_KBD.
>
> This was seen on an Intel S1200RP_SE with firmware
> S1200RP.86B.02.02.0005.102320140911, version 4.6, date 2014-10-23.
>
> Based on the following Linux commits:
> de18c850af70 ("x86: EFI runtime service support: EFI runtime services")
> a4f1987e4c54 ("x86, reboot: Add EFI and CF9 reboot methods into the
> default list")
> 44be28e9dd98 ("x86/reboot: Add EFI reboot quirk for ACPI Hardware
> Reduced flag")
>
> Signed-off-by: Ross Lagerwall <ross.lagerwall@xxxxxxxxxx>
You should avoid the internal ticket reference in the subject.
If Jan is happy, this could be fixed up on commit.
For the patch itself, Reviewed-by: Andrew Cooper <andrew.cooper3@xxxxxxxxxx>
